Output 21cb100cbfc20679536dc39f7497f94bf219aa274118a8fec28eb0b1a8e80001:0

value
2380500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3c42fd4b7c373e11431589db5a5122df293bb20 OP_EQUALVERIFY OP_CHECKSIG
address
1PDvDv6LCD4TE6fYm4sGPVep4ysgmnH29A
transaction
21cb100cbfc20679536dc39f7497f94bf219aa274118a8fec28eb0b1a8e80001
confirmations
506370
spent
true